In the rapidly evolving landscape of American politics, it is crucial for business leaders to recognize their role as catalysts for positive change. This interactive webinar will equip business leaders to mobilize employees and other stakeholders to participate in the democratic process, foster a culture of civic responsibility, and contribute to the broader democratic discourse

Speakers

John Anner, PhD is a Senior Philanthropic Advisor at the Movement Voter Project. He has more than 30 years of experience leading nonprofit organizations, including Thrive Networks, the Independent Press Association, Coral Reef Alliance, and the Ella Baker Center for Human Rights, and has conducted extensive research on the use of impact measurement as a critical success factor for social enterprises.

Billy Wimsatt is the Founder and Executive Director of the Movement Voter Project and has more than 25 years of experience in journalism, philanthropy, organizing, and social entrepreneurship, and has advised hundreds of donors to strategically invest tens of millions of dollars in hundreds of organizations and initiatives in 48 states, often with crucial seed funding to start, to scale, to launch c4s and PACs, and to voterize their work. He prides himself on talent scouting, offering nurturing support and coaching, and facilitating a spirit of strategic collaboration.
